Dr. Numb Lidocaine Cream 4% is a topical anesthetic that temporarily relieves pain and itching due to insect bites, minor burns, minor scrapes, minor skin irritations, minor cuts, and sunburns. It contains lidocaine 4% and other ingredients such as benzyl alcohol, carbopol, lecithin, propylene glycol, tocopheryl acetate and water. It is for external use only and should be applied up to 3 to 4 times a day to the affected area. However, do not use in large quantities, particularly over raw surfaces or blistered areas. Seek medical attention if there is no improvement or worsening of the condition within 7 days or if any redness, swelling, and pain occurs. Keep out of reach of children and if swallowed, contact Poison Control Center immediately. Imported and distributed by Shinpharma, Inc. in Blaine, Washington.*
